What are the layers of paas architecture?

The layers of PaaS (Platform-as-a-Service) architecture include the front-end application layer, middleware layer, database layer, and infrastructure layer. The front-end application layer includes web frameworks, APIs, and user interfaces. The middleware layer includes services like messaging systems, workflow engines, and business process management tools. The database layer includes database management systems, while the infrastructure layer includes virtualization, storage, and networking components.
